Cesidio Di Ciacca, born 1954 in Cockenzie, a fishing village outside Edinburgh, attended Scotus Academy and graduated LLB (Hons) from Edinburgh University in 1975. He worked as a solicitor in private practice until 1994. Married to Selina and with two children, Sofia (21, who is an honours graduate in History of Art and currently studying for a law degree at Edinburgh University) and Giovanni (who is 12, with Downs Syndrome, which does not seem to limit his expectations!).
Since then, he has been an adviser to Scarborough Group International Ltd (an international property investment and development company) and a number of other companies in various industries. He is a non executive chairman of Chardon Management Limited (a hotel management company) and of Blairston Enterprises Ltd (an investment company) and is an executive director of Scarborough Partnership Limited and various other companies as well as Trustee of two charities.
Three of his gradparents were born in Italy (in Picinisco and Figliniano – both in the Terra Sancti Benedicti) and this has given him a love and an understanding of the country. He lives part of the year in Ischia and is currently developing a small luxury Apart-Hotel in Picinisco as well as conducting extensive research into the history of that area and into the causes and circumstances of emigration and the particular links between this comune and Scotland.
Family, reading (especially European Social History), music and travel are his main interests (but good company, good wine, the culinary arts and the occasional fishing match, game of golf, football match or shoot are appreciated).
